Subex Rises After Securing Fraud Management Upgrade Deal with Middle East Operator

Bengaluru, October 15 (Udaipur Kiran): Shares of Subex Ltd edged higher after the company announced an upgrade engagement with a leading communications service provider in the Middle East. The stock was trading at Rs. 14.22, up by 0.11 points or 0.78% from its previous close of Rs. 14.11 on the BSE.

The scrip opened at Rs. 14.34 and recorded a high of Rs. 14.58 and a low of Rs. 14.08 during the session. Around 1,55,912 shares were traded on the counter. The BSE Group ‘A’ stock, with a face value of Rs. 5, has touched a 52-week high of Rs. 27.70 (08-Nov-2024) and a 52-week low of Rs. 10.57 (07-Apr-2025).

During the past week, the stock traded between Rs. 14.58 and Rs. 11.91. The company’s current market capitalisation stands at Rs. 799.17 crore. Institutional investors hold 0.79% of the shares, while non-institutional investors hold 99.21%.

Subex has entered into a strategic upgrade engagement with a marquee telecom operator in the Middle East to enhance its Fraud Management (FM) capabilities. The operator, which manages a nationwide 5G/4G/fibre network, acts as a key digital hub connecting Europe, Asia, and Africa through global partnerships and subsea infrastructure.

The engagement will begin with a comprehensive risk assessment by the Subex Consulting team to identify operational gaps and areas for improvement. This will be followed by the upgrade of the operator’s Fraud Management System to the HyperSense Fraud Management System, designed to provide enhanced flexibility, analytics-driven prevention, and faster investigation capabilities.

Subex provides a wide range of telecom solutions, including Revenue Assurance, Fraud Management, Credit Risk Management, Interconnect Billing, Interparty Management, Route Optimization, and Cost Management.
